The phrase "a ambitious attack" is not correct in English.
It should be "an ambitious attack" because "ambitious" begins with a vowel sound. You can use this phrase when describing an attack that is bold, daring, or has high aspirations, often in a strategic or competitive context.
Example: "The team's ambitious attack on the market surprised their competitors and led to significant growth."
Alternatives: "a bold attack" or "a daring attack".
